Job Opportunities at Georgia Military College Fayetteville Campus

Hey everyone, been thinking about getting a job while at school to help out with expenses. I'll be going to the Fayetteville Campus of GMC, so was just wondering if anyone knew what kind of job opportunities exist there?

2 years ago

Definitely a smart move to consider employment while pursuing your education! GMC Fayetteville, like most college campuses, might have positions designed specifically for students. These often include roles like peer tutoring, work-study positions (if you're eligible for federal work-study assistance), administrative support roles in different departments, IT support, and maybe even part-time positions in campus facilities like the dining hall or campus bookstore.

While specific job postings could vary, I would recommend checking out GMC Fayetteville's website or getting in touch with their office of student employment or career services to get accurate information. They should be able to guide you on job applications and give you a list of current openings if any.

Apart from campus jobs, you can also consider looking for work in the local Fayetteville area. There might be part-time opportunities in industries such as retail, food service, or tutoring high school students, for example. Check out local job boards or websites for listings.

Remember to balance work commitments with your academic workload. Part-time employment can help build skills and reduce dependence on loans, but prioritize your studies and personal well-being. Good luck with your job hunt!
